Since I had requested this product be made to precede coatings, I never really tested it on bad paint as I would have always been compounding and polishing before coating. I was presented with an opportunity I couldn't pass up. This 2010 Lexus had been coated by me with OG 2 years ago. The coating seemed to hold up well after washing as it was sheeting very well. However, the drip stains from this mirror were disheartening. I honestly don't know why they bit into the coating like they did.
Anyway, to remove it, I thought I would first try the SC with a mf pad (I think it was the cutting pad, but it was an Optimum one and they're not labelled) and my Rupes at about speed 4-4.5. The after shot was done only after one pass with SC. I was very impressed to say the least. You can see the reflection of the Rupes in the door.
